In plastics processing, precise temperature control is critical for the quality and efficiency of the production process. Conformal cooling is an innovative solution that delivers coolant directly to the cutting zone or close to the molded part, rather than just to the surface.
Conformal cooling in Moldex3D refers to the software's ability to predict the effects of conformal cooling on mold design and performance. Moldex3D allows engineers and designers to simulate and analyze transient temperatures in the injection molding process. This enables a more accurate design of cooling channels based on the contours of the product to optimize the cooling rate. By using conformal cooling, cycle times can be reduced and product quality can be improved. Moldex3D is a useful tool to effectively take advantage of conformal cooling and increase the efficiency of the injection molding process.
With the conformal cooling add-on license, a wizard can be run to assist in the design. In the wizard, the model and a curve must be selected. The parameters axis direction, distance from cavity to cooling channel and cooling channel diameter must then be entered. The minimum distance between two channels is 3 mm. Note: 'preview' allows you to view the cooling channel without creating it.
